Lenexa, Kansas, located in central Johnson County, is home to about 48,000 residents. The city of Lenexa is served by the award winning school districts of Olathe, Shawnee Mission and De Soto. The city has a mix of established neighborhoods in the east and a fast growing area in the west. There are over 30 different parks in Lenexa, including the 80 acre Lake Lenexa at Black Hoof park, and a number of large boulevards and parkways, such as Prairie Star Parkway and Renner Boulevard that welcome residents and businesses alike. UPS and Quest Diagnostics are the city’s top employers.
The Lenexa Chili Challenge on October 14-15, 2016 is a fun event that people of all ages can enjoy! Hundreds of teams compete to see who can come out on top in the chili, salsa and hot wing contests. Friday night includes fireworks and live music. Saturday is when the contests start and when attendees can sample foods for free. Activities include the Hot Pepper Eating Contest and Kids Kornbread, a contest where children 12 and under can compete for making the best cornbread. The Chili Challenge will be held in Old Town Lenexa at Santa Fe Trail Drive and Pflumm Road.
